One of the most popular natural supplements for digestion is **probiotics**. These beneficial bacteria can help restore the natural balance of microbes in your gut, which is essential for good digestion and immune function. Probiotics might relieve sym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), bloating, and constipation. Sources of probiotics include fermented foods such as y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ut, or you can choose a high-quality supplement to ensure you’re getting the right strains and amounts.
Another effective option is **digestive enzymes**. Our bodies naturally produce enzymes to help break down food, but factors such as age and diet can impair this production. Supplementing with digestive enzymes can assist in the breakdown of proteins, fats, and carbohydrates, aiding absorption and minimizing bloating. Look for broad-spectrum digestive enzyme supplements that contain a mix of enzymes like amylase, protease, and lipase to ensure comprehensive support for your digestive system.
**Fiber** is also essential for maintaining regularity and promoting digestive health. While it’s best to get fiber from whole foods like fruits, vegetables, legumes, and grains, some people may find it challenging to consume enough. Fiber supplements such as psyllium husk, inulin, or acacia fiber can help increase your daily intake, leading to more regular bowel movements and reduced bloating. However, it’s important to introduce fiber gradually and drink plenty of water to avoid discomfort.
**Ginger** is another natural remedy celebrated for its digestive benefits. Traditionally used to combat nausea, ginger also promotes the production of digestive juices and helps relax the intestinal muscles. Whether you consume it in tea, supplement form, or fresh, ginger can be particularly beneficial for alleviating bloating and discomfort after eating.
For those struggling with inflammation in the gut, **curcumin**, the active compound found in turmeric, could be a game changer. Curcumin is known for its anti-inflammatory properties and can help reduce symptoms of digestive distress. Taking curcumin supplements, often combined with black pepper extract (which enhances absorption), may support digestion and improve gut health.
**Peppermint** is another well-known herb that can help soothe the digestive tract. Its natural menthol content can help relieve bloating and gas while promoting healthy bile flow for better digestion. You can consume peppermint tea or take enteric-coated peppermint oil capsules, which ensure that the oil is released in the intestines where it’s needed most, providing relief from discomfort.
